I am using an MSI MPG X570 Gaming Pro Carbon Wifi Motherboard and I don't want to download the Raid drivers, however uninstalling my SATA drivers and restarting my computer does nothing and I cannot for the life of me figure out how to get them updating. Updating through Device Manager and choosing to search online tells me my drivers are up to date(version installed is from 2006). The SATA ports recognize my external DVD drive and when I put a disc in the drive makes the sound and my mouse gets the little dvd next to it but the drive isn't available in File Explorer and nothing else happens computer-wise. I have the installation disc for my motherboard but...it's clear why it can't be used lol.
Does anyone know of a fix for this? Thank you!

Windows furnishes up-to-date and fully functional Standard SATA AHCI drivers for AM4 chipsets.

You only need the AMD RAID drivers if you're going to set up a Raid array. I don't know if it still is, but it used to be a 'Bad Idea' (tm) to install them if you're not as uninstalling means repartitioning and reformatting the drives with data loss guaranteed if not properly backed up.
